Regarding removing artifacts from the catalogues, I would argue that
they should not be there in the first place, and are indicative of
a failure in a previous QC.  Certainly hot pixels should be removed
from the images and not at the late stage of the catalogues.  Either
the bad pixel masks need to be improved (I thought, though, that they
worked fine), or your SExtractor -DETECT_MINAREA parameter is too
small.  Sex should not be detecting single pixels.

I think that a curve of growth is the way to go.  A very good algorithm
is given by Stetson in:
http://adsabs.harvard.edu/cgi-bin/nph-bib_query?1990PASP..102..932S
It is also available in the DAOgrow algorithm (Stetson 1990), implemented in the
task mkapfile in digiphotx.photcalx (IRAF).
